Rogers Kappa 438 High Frequency PCB Fabrication for Advanced Wireless and IoT Applications
Introduction Rogers Kappa 438 high-frequency laminate addresses the evolving performance demands of modern wireless systems beyond traditional FR-4 capabilities. Designed with a glass-reinforced hydrocarbon ceramic system, it delivers superior dielectric properties, reduced signal loss, and tight tolerances while maintaining compatibility with standard FR-4 manufacturing processes. This makes Kappa 438 an ideal solution for next-generation RF applications including 5G infrastructure, carrier-grade Wi-Fi, and IoT communications.
